Anthrax has triggered a mass die-off of hippos residing inside Africa’s oldest nature reserve within the Democratic Republic of Congo. Officers at Virunga Nationwide Park report that at the very least 50 hippos, together with different massive animals, had been just lately killed by the bacterial illness.
Media shops reported on the hippo slaughter Tuesday, which seems to have begun final week. In keeping with park park director Emmanuel de Merode, the hippos had been discovered useless floating in a river south of Lake Edward. Although officers have reached the world, they haven’t been in a position to get well and bury the our bodies but.
“It’s tough as a result of lack of entry and logistics,” De Merode told Reuters. “We’ve the means to restrict the unfold (of the illness) by…burying them with caustic soda.”
Anthrax is attributable to Bacillus micro organism, often Bacillus anthracis. Its signs differ relying on how the micro organism enter the physique, however the inhaled type of anthrax is particularly harmful. With out immediate antibiotic and antitoxin remedy, inhalation anthrax is nearly universally fatal in humans. This excessive fatality price and its airborne potential has made anthrax one of many extra regarding bioterror threats around.
Fortunately, pure anthrax is a rare disease in people, and folks usually catch it from contaminated animals or contaminated animal merchandise. The micro organism may lay dormant within the soil as spores, which may then be inhaled by each individuals and animals. Current anthrax vaccines exist for livestock and folks at greater threat of publicity (similar to navy personnel), however anthrax will sometimes trigger mass die-offs of animals.
In 2017, as an illustration, anthrax is suspected to have killed over 100 hippos on the Bwabwata nationwide park in northeast Namibia. In 2016, an outbreak in Russia killed greater than 2,000 reindeer and a 12-year-old little one. And in 2004, anthrax was responsible for killing round 300 hippos in Uganda’s Queen Elizabeth Nationwide Park.
These newest deaths are an particularly heavy toll for the native hippo inhabitants. Over the previous few many years, as a result of intensive poaching and warfare, the variety of hippos within the park dwindled from 20,000 to a couple hundred by 2006, in response to Reuters. Conservation efforts since have steadily elevated the inhabitants, although there are nonetheless just one,200 hippos estimated to be residing there.
Given the present transmission threat, the Congolese Institute for Nature Conservation has suggested individuals residing within the space to keep away from wildlife and boil any water gathered from native sources in the interim.
